Population & Demographics

The following information lists the population statistics and breakdown for the 75189 zip code. The total population is 35243, of which, 16536 are male and 18707 are female. With a total area of 287.611 square miles, the population density is 101.3 people per square mile. The median age of the population is 35.5 years old. Income & Economic Characteristics

The median inflation-adjusted family income in the 75189 zip code is $106109. This is 53.17% greater than the national average. This income places 3.9% of the population below the poverty line. The average retirement income for individuals in this zip code (for those that have it) is $23393. Education

In the 75189 zip code, 91.9% of individuals over 25 years old have a high school degree or higher, and 26.9% have a bachelors degree or higher. Occupation and Work Characteristics

In the 75189 zip, there are an estimated 18370 people in the labor force, of which, 17622 are employed, and 727 are unemployed. There are a total of 21 people in the armed forces. The average commute time for this zip code is 35.5 minutes. Of the total people that work, 1479 worked from home and 17283 commuted. The average number of hours worked is 40.2. Housing

The median home value for the 75189 zip code is 248500. There is an estimated  11731 number of occupied housing units, the median gross rent in is $1518 per month, and the average monthly housing costs are estimated to be $1604.
